Dengue Spreads To 28 Districts Of Odisha

Bhubaneswar: The dengue outbreak has assumed alarming proportions in Odisha this year as it has spread to 28 districts.
Informing the media on Saturday, Director (Health Services) Braja Kishore Brahma said dengue cases have been identified in 28 out of 30 districts of the state till date.

“As against 412 dengue patients identified in the state last year, the number this year has gone up to 1841 till August 25,” he added.

Talking about the district-wise number of patients, Brahma said Khurda district has the highest 512 patients of which 492 belong to Bhubaneswar Municipal Corporation (BMC) limits.

While the vector-borne disease claimed two lives last year, three have died this year, he added.
